Baseball Recap: Stanwood Spartans vs. Everett Seagulls
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Stanwood). They blew past the Everett Seagulls 9-1 on Monday. The result was nothing new for the Spartans, who have now won four contests by seven runs or more so far this season.
Cullen Maloney looked comfortable as he tossed two innings while giving up no earned runs or hits. He has been consistent recently: he hasn't given up more than two walks in four consecutive appearances.

At the plate, Skyler McLain was incredible, going 2-for-3 with four RBI, one triple, and one run. Those four RBI gave him a new career-high. Another player making a difference was Corban Forslund, who scored two runs while going 1-for-3.
Stanwood pushed their record up to 11-1 with the win, which was their third straight on the road. The road victories came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 8.0 runs over those games. As for Everett, their defeat 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 5-8.
Looking ahead, Stanwood will face off against Mountlake Terrace at 4:00 p.m. on Wednesday. Everett will be paying especially close attention to the Spartans' match: after the Spartans faces off against the Hawks, they'll take on Everett again at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day.
